IMHO, all of these electronic compasses in the wrist watches are not good for navigation simply because the sensor used in them have something like 50 positions, i.o.w. its like ~7 deg. precision. You can tell where the North is, but I doubt it's good for any serious navigation by azimuth bearing in the field. Also take a closer look at those "cool" bezels on them. Marks every 30 deg.? laugh Almost any analog compass is better.
